Phaser 3 matter physics. Jul 30, 2025 · Phaser.
Phaser 3 matter physics. Jul 30, 2025 · Phaser.
Phaser 3 matter physics. MatterPhysics Phaser. Jul 30, 2025 · Matter JS is an open-source third party physics library and Phaser has its own custom version of it bundled. js, so prepare for a series of tutorials about Phaser 3 and Matter. MatterMatterCollisionFilter <static> MatterCollisionFilter An Object that specifies the collision filtering properties of this body. The reason for including Matter is that it provides a more advanced 'full body' physics system. Jul 30, 2025 · Phaser. PhysicsEditorParser Phaser. PhysicsJSONParser Phaser. The tutorial explains: Screenshot of the example: Source code for the physics tutorial at www. In this tutorial, we’re going to explore collisions once more in a Phaser game, but this time with Matter. Types. js is another supported physics engine in Phaser 3. co Feb 21, 2018 · I think you can make complex physics games using Matter. MatterGameObject Phaser. Unlike Arcade Physics, the other physics system provided with Phaser, Matter JS is a full-body physics system. Access this via this. It also handles delta timing, bounds, body and constraint creation and debug drawing. js and more refined boundaries. This class creates a Matter JS World Composite along with the Matter JS Engine during instantiation. x and while it offers quite a bit of functionality that arcade physics doesn’t offer, it also offers custom polygon physics bodies. ourcade. matter. Aug 23, 2020 · We're going to be setting it up with the Matter physics plugin, this will give us quick and easy access to collision detection and movement for our game objects. Sprite Phaser. This class acts as an interface between a Phaser Scene and a single instance of the Matter Engine. Let's go through the basic setup that you'll need for basically any Phaser 3 project. Matter Phaser. Creating new objects and allocating memory inside update loops is a common cause of framerate drops. . Collisions between two bodies will obey the following rules: If the two bodies have the same non-zero value of collisionFilter. Uh oh! Jul 30, 2025 · The Phaser Matter plugin provides the ability to use the Matter JS Physics Engine within your Phaser games. world from within a Scene. com/physicseditor/tutorials/how-to-create-physics-shapes-for-phaser-3-and-matterjs. Image Phaser. If you wish to access the Matter JS World Jul 30, 2025 · The Matter Factory is responsible for quickly creating a variety of different types of bodies, constraints and Game Objects and adding them into the physics world. Jul 30, 2025 · Matter Physics is an open-source third party physics library and Phaser has its own custom version of it bundled. codeandweb. Physics. PointerConstraint Phaser. Use it to access the most common Matter features and helper functions. See full list on blog. js, as soon as I figure out how to get the most out of this engine, meanwhile download the source code. " Read More Jul 30, 2025 · Phaser. World Jan 31, 2020 · Object Pooling in Phaser 3 with Matter Physics Use Object Pools with Physics Bodies in Phaser 3 by Tommy Leung on January 31, 2020 7 minute read Maintaining a good framerate is important for games where players are expected to react in realtime. group, they will always collide if the value is positive, and they will never collide if the value is negative. If Jul 30, 2025 · The Matter World class is responsible for managing one single instance of a Matter Physics World for Phaser. TileBody Phaser. This respository contains the example source code for the How to create physics shapes for Phaser 3 and Matter JS tutorial. Matter. May 17, 2021 · Matter. jsu zjm hdiiw tgv kbqbv lypz weak hsfm wvgxke vaeaqzfv